10-22-2015 , 05:45 PM
i wouldn't worry about it. i can't comment on US payouts specifically, but this group has been paying out pretty fast via skrill and neteller for a while now. max payout is 10k and usually takes 2-3 days.

i received a wire from them once and that was a huge hassle, but it did eventually arrive. if you run into issues and can't get a hold of a competent csr, they work pretty well with sbr

10-23-2015 , 04:13 PM
I haven't used bitcoin. Not sure why MG. is just $400 and WU. is 600. When I get to the point where I am withdrawing 1k or more that ATM only card option looks neat. It is maxed at $2,500 and a money order you can get over 9K although the Money order option is only on their sister site Betonline. Not sure why.
